GPU常用命令

  1. 平台信息

adb shell dumpsys SurfaceFlinger | grep GLES

GLES: Imagination Technologies, PowerVR Rogue GE8300, OpenGL ES 3.2 build 1.15@6070602

  1. 负载信息

adb shell dumpsys gpu

Stable Game Driver: unsupported

Pre-release Game Driver: unsupported

Memory snapshot for GPU 0:

Global total: 362020864

Proc 474 total: 18446744072067452928

  1. 天玑2000及以前

# 频率档位

adb shell "cat /proc/gpufreq/gpufreq_opp_dump"

[0] freq = 660000, volt = 80000, vsram = 87500, gpufreq_power = 726

[1] freq = 500000, volt = 70000, vsram = 87500, gpufreq_power = 419

[2] freq = 390000, volt = 65000, vsram = 87500, gpufreq_power = 286

# 固定频率

adb shell "echo 660000 > /proc/gpufreq/gpufreq_opp_freq"

# 当前频率、档位、负载

$ adb shell "grep -E 'g_cur_opp_idx|real freq|gpu_loading' /proc/gpufreq/gpufreq_var_dump"

g_cur_opp_idx = 2, g_cur_opp_cond_idx = 2

real freq = 390000, real volt = 0, real vsram_volt = 87500

gpu_loading = 0

  1. 天玑2000以后

# 频率档位

adb shell "cat /proc/gpufreqv2/stack_working_opp_table"

adb shell "cat /proc/gpufreqv2/gpu_working_opp_table"

# 固定频率

adb shell "echo 0 > /proc/gpufreqv2/fix_target_opp_index" # -1 无限制,0 最高频

# 当前频率

adb shell "grep -e STACK-OPP /proc/gpufreqv2/gpufreq_status"

  • 4
    点赞
  • 10
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值